Noteworthy Benefits of Lithium-Ion batteries:

Lithium-ion batteries offer several benefits over the conventional options, such as:

High energy density:

Lithium-ion batteries have a high energy density, which allows them to store a lot of power in a relatively compact and light container. They are consequently appropriate for utilization in mobile devices and laptops.

Longer life cycle:

Lithium-ion batteries may be recharged and used for a long time without having to be replaced because of their long life cycle. They are thus, a sensible financial and environmental decision.

Low maintenance:

Lithium-ion batteries do not need to be completely discharged before recharging and do not experience the "memory effect," which may damage other types of batteries, and they require comparatively lesser maintenance.

Low self-discharge rate:

Lithium-ion batteries can hold a charge for long periods without recharging due to their low self-discharge rate. Due to this, they may be utilized in seldom-used gadgets.

Reusability:

Lithium-ion batteries may be used again since they are reusable. As a result, they are more affordable and environmentally favorable than throwaway batteries.

Environment friendly:

These batteries have a comparatively minimal environmental impact. They are reusable and devoid of hazardous elements like lead or cadmium.

Demerits of Lithium-Ion batteries:

However, Lithium-ion batteries may have some drawbacks despite their many advantages, including:

Susceptibility to high temperatures:

Due to their susceptibility to high temperatures, lithium-ion batteries may progressively deteriorate and lose capability. This can be a problem in muggy environments or when using machinery that generates a lot of heat.

Thermal runaway danger:

Thermal runaway causes these batteries to overcharge and catch fire. There may be a danger if the battery is not managed or kept correctly.

Limited availability of raw materials:

Lithium-ion batteries require substances such as nickel, cobalt, and lithium, none of which are readily available in large quantities. This might cause problems with the supply chain and perhaps drive up their prices.

Rigid handling and disposal norms:

Lithium-ion batteries need cautious handling and disposal to avoid harm to the environment. Improper disposal may lead to harmful substances seeping into the soil or water.

Production and transportation emissions:

The manufacture and transportation of lithium-ion batteries may create greenhouse gas emissions and other environmental pollutants. This can be an issue for folks who are worried about the environmental impact of such batteries.

Types of Lithium-Ion Cells

LFP (Lithium Iron Phosphate), NMC (Nickel Manganese Cobalt), NCA (Nickel Cobalt Aluminum), and LCO (Lithium Cobalt Oxide) cells are only a few of the several types of lithium-ion cells that are available. The chemistry, power, voltage capacity, and general performance of these cells differ. For instance, LFP batteries have great thermal stability and electrochemical performance throughout a long life cycle. They often take the place of lead-acid deep-cycle batteries. Mobile phones, PCs, and electronic cameras all use LCO batteries because of their high specific energy.

Additionally, lithium-ion batteries exist in several shapes, such as cylindrical, pouch, and prismatic. Cylindrical lithium cells are the most common type of battery pack and are extensively utilized in drones, power tools, medical equipment, and children's toys. Lithium pouch cells are lighter and more cost-effective than conventional cells. Prismatic lithium batteries have a great storage capacity and rectangular form.

Different Lithium-ion Batteries and Their Uses 

Different lithium-ion batteries are utilized for diverse purposes. 

Lithium Iron Phosphate (LFP): 

This battery has phosphate as a cathode in its cell. Such batteries have low resistivity, thus increasing thermal stability. Lithium-Ion Phosphate batteries are commonly used in the electric two-wheeler industry for their safety, extended life cycle, and strong temperature stability. 

Lithium Cobalt Oxide (LCO): 

Lithium-Ion batteries, made with cobalt and lithium carbonate, are known as lithium cobalt oxide batteries. The anode comprises graphite, and the cathode is of cobalt oxide. LOC batteries are utilized in mobile phones, computers, and electronic cameras because of their high specific energy. 

Nickel Manganese Cobalt (NMC) and Nickel Cobalt Aluminum (NCA): 

These are the most common lithium-ion batteries used in many areas. These are considered to be safer batteries due to their high-temperature tolerance. These batteries are also employed in diverse applications like electric vehicles, medical devices, PCs, and more.

Learn the Benefits of Using a Lead-Acid Battery in India

Did you know that lead acid batteries were Invented in the 1850s? Lead acid batteries were the first rechargeable batteries meant for commercial use.

Even today, you can barely find a cost-effective alternative to it. Whether a golf cart, a wheelchair, or a UPS system, a lead-acid battery helps to run such machines smoothly.

In fact, it is an ideal rechargeable battery type you can use in applications that require high-load currents. The battery is widely used in different vehicles and commercial appliances.

Two types of lead-acid batteries are available: sealed lead-acid batteries and AGM batteries. Sealed lead-acid (SLA) batteries are classified into two types- Small sealed lead-acid and larger valve-regulated lead-acid (VLVA) batteries.

Sealed acid batteries are used in emergency lighting, wheelchairs, healthcare sectors, etc. You can use AGM batteries in motorcycles, micro-hybrid cars, RVs and marine vehicles that require some cycling.

But why are lead-acid batteries used so widely? Is there any notable advantage of these batteries? Yes, they have certain benefits.

In this article, we will discuss such benefits in detail, safety measures for its use, and also the factors to consider while buying lead-acid batteries.

The Benefits of Using Lead-Acid Battery

Despite having other alternatives, people prefer using lead-acid batteries in many cases. The major perks of using this battery are:

Cost-effective

Lead-acid batteries, unlike other rechargeable batteries, are lower in cost. You can use it in applications where newer battery chemistries can be costly. One of the reasons for this low cost is its simple manufacturing process.

High self-discharge current

The self-discharge for this battery is about 40% per year. On the other hand, nickel-cadmium type self-discharges the same amount in three months. Due to its low self-discharge, lead-acid batteries can store charge for up to 2 years.

No requirement for cell-wise BMS

Lithium-ion batteries can be used in particular conditions. Hence, BMS or battery management system is necessary for it. It monitors the battery when it gets overcharged.

Lead-acid batteries do not need them. When you overcharge these batteries, they use the surplus energy to electrolyse water into Hydrogen and Oxygen. Thus, it equalises all blocks or cells. The highest charged ones will go into that mode and sit there while the others reach there.

Good performance in extreme temperatures

A lead-acid battery works well in both high and low temperatures. The operating temperature ranges from -40 degrees F to 120 degrees F. Anyways, for extreme temperature cases, you should use batteries specifically designed for difficult applications.

Reliable and smooth technology

The technology used in these batteries is mature. If used correctly, a lead-acid battery can last long, providing reliable service.

Troubleshooting Common Issues with Lead-Acid Batteries

Even a minor issue with a lead-acid battery can cause huge trouble sometimes. Those issues may lead to poor performance of the appliance. Also, it affects the durability of the battery and the machine in which it is used.

Therefore, it is essential to troubleshoot the problems at the earliest. Hence, in this article, we will discuss how you can fix common issues with a lead-acid battery.

This article will talk about troubleshooting both types. They are AGM (Absorbed Glass Mat) and Sealed Lead-acid (SLA) batteries. Also, we will point out some preventive measures for these common issues. Finally, you will learn how to prolong the battery's life.

Troubleshooting Common Issues with Lead-Acid Battery

A lead-acid battery, be it an SLA or AGM battery, may pose problems at any time. The major reasons behind such issues are usually poor quality material, no proper maintenance, etc.

Anyways, whatever the reason is, you must fix the problem before it gets worse. So, here we share the troubleshooting processes:

Instant Fluctuation of the Battery Percentage

A sudden decrease or increase in battery percentage depends largely on terminal voltage. And this voltage is affected by the charge and discharge currents.

The charge current can quickly increase the voltage of a resting battery during the first minute of charge. It results in an instant increase in battery percentage. But, once that charge current is stopped, the battery percentage decreases suddenly.

Also, the discharge current can cause an immediate decrease in battery percentage at the first minute of discharge. But when the current is stopped, the voltage rapidly rises to the resting level, and the battery percentage increases instantly.

To resolve the issue and find an accurate battery percentage, disconnect the battery from the whole system and rest it for 2 hours at least before taking the measurement.

The battery bank does not accept charging or discharges too fast

It might be a result of the failure of your battery bank. When such an issue occurs, identify the lagging battery in the bank first.

A lagging battery comes with a lower voltage than other batteries in the bank. Charge and discharge the battery thrice to see if any battery shows a lower voltage than the average voltage bank by more than 5%.

Then, equalise the battery bank with proper equalisation charge parameters. If that battery bank issue is still there, the lagging battery may have failed.

Then, disconnect it from power sources and loads. Next, use a battery generator to rejuvenate the battery. If the issue is not solved, replace the lagging battery.

The acid leaks, swells up, or releases vapours

Three of them are crucial issues. With a cracked casing, the sulfuric acid electrolyte in a battery starts seeping out and causes corrosion to the things in the surrounding areas. Thus acid leaks take place. You must handle the battery to prevent it.

A battery's positive and negative plates can exert pressure on the inner wall and make the battery case swell up. It might be a result of overcharging or short-circuiting. Make sure you do not overcharge

These issues are mostly seen in sealed lead-acid batteries. For AGM batteries, regular damages may not cause any harm due to their materials. Anyways, you must check other performance issues.

If your AGM battery shows poor performance, you can apply some ways. For example:

  • Check for damage. Although minor damage cannot harm, you should find and repair it soon.
  • Inspect the gravity of the acid within the battery fluid. The fluid will be clear without any discolouration if the battery is fine.
  • Check the voltage of the battery after charging. It should be 100% before use. If it is less than 100%, recharge it. If the problem still occurs, the battery might have a problem.
  • Load test inspection is another way. You should replace the battery if the test voltage is below the minimum.

How to Prevent the Common Issues with Lead-Acid Batteries

Troubleshooting the issue is fine. But, the better is when you prevent the issues beforehand from occurring. Things that you can do are:

  • Fully recharge the battery after using and before storing it to avoid the undercharging issue.
  • If the battery is stored for a long period, charge it every few weeks.
  • Check water levels frequently and refill the cells with distilled water as required.
  • Avoid overwatering. A regular fluid level is around ½ inch above the plates' top or just below the vent's bottom. Maintain it.

How to prolong lead-acid battery life

Before we end today's discussion, here are some tips to prolong battery life.

  • Never discharge the battery below 50%
  • Connect power sources on the bank's opposite corners for an even charging and discharging for every battery.
  • Stick to the maximum limitations of charge and discharge current.
  • You should store the battery in a dry and cool place.

Where can you use an ink cartridge?

An ink cartridge is a container used in inkjet printers to hold ink. Depending on the cartridge type, the ink can be poured onto paper scribbling words through various processes.

Well, you might doubt whether the ink cartridge can be used in non-inkjet printers or not. Let us tell you that non-inkjet printers, like laser printers, dot-matrix printers, 3D printers, etc., do not use ink cartridges.

Instead, laser printers use toner cartridges. Dot Matrix printers include ribbon cartridges that comprise a cassette and an ink-soaked fabric. So, if you buy an ink cartridge, it can only be used in an inkjet cartridge.

Types of ink cartridges

As per the design of inkjet printers, two types of cartridges are available. They are based on the source of manufacturing. The types are- thermal and piezoelectric.

Thermal ink cartridges

Most inkjet printers for consumers work with this mechanism. Inside the reservoir, you can find a heating item with a tiny resistor. When the printer sends a signal to the cartridge, a small stream flows through the plate or resistor, warming the resistor.

The ink adjacent to it is vaporised into a small steam bubble inside the nozzle. Thus, ink droplets are forced out of the nozzle onto the paper.

Piezoelectric ink cartridges

Instead of heating elements, a piezoelectric crystal is used inside these cartridges. Most of the Epson printers come with it. When current is used, the crystal transforms its design or size.

It increases the pressure inside the channel through which ink passes. And thus, it forces ink from the cartridge nozzle.

Based on the source of manufacturing, the types are-

OEM or Original Equipment Manufacturer cartridges:

Known as branded or genuine cartridges, OEM cartridges are the most expensive among all types of cartridges. Anyways, they produce high-quality prints that last long.

With the brand attached to them, these cartridges are designed to be used in their printers only.
For example, HP designs cartridges for their printers.

They are tailored to specific manufacturers’ printers’ nature and other aspects. So, no risk of damage to printers is assured. They work perfectly well and come with a warranty.

Compatible Cartridges

Designed by third-party manufacturers, these cartridges do not carry brand names like HP, Canon, etc. The price of these cartridges is lower than OEM cartridges and can fit many types of printers.

If you have lots of print jobs to do, you can opt for them. They are cost-effective and work quickly.

The print quality may not be as good as what OEM cartridges produce. All printers cannot work with such compatible cartridges. So, you have to buy it carefully.

Also, some of them never fit the printers properly. As a result, the risk of damages remains.

Remanufactured Cartridges:

They are recycled cartridges. They can be new units designed from old cartridge mechanisms. Or, they can be old, empty cartridges cleaned and refilled with ink.

They are built with original cartridges. So, they can work well with your printers, unlike compatible cartridges.

It is the most eco-friendly and cheapest option among all cartridge types. But, to ensure quality, you should buy remanufactured cartridges with a brand’s guarantee.

How to check the ink levels in cartridges?

In every way, don't forget to turn on the printer. Installing printer software is also essential in most ways. If you check it in Windows, you can do it in two ways.

One is from the notification bar icon

1. Right-click on the printer icon at the bottom right corner of the windows screen.
2. Select “properties” or “preferences” from the menu.

The other way is through the control panel

1. Click on the Windows key and search the control panel.
2. Under the “hardware and sound” option, click on “view devices and printers.”
3. Double-click on the printer that you want to check ink.
4. You can see ink levels in the “status” section.

If you check on macOS, the steps are as follows:

1. Click on the Apple icon at the screen’s top left side and look for the “system preferences” option.
2. Click on that option and find the “Printers & Scanners, Print & Scan, or Print & Fax icon.”
3. Select the printer and click the “options and supply” button on the right.

You can also check the ink level on the printer’s LCD screen. The steps are:

1. Find the “menu” or “home” option.
2. Look for the right navigation key to check the status, reports, or settings.

How to Refill Ink Cartridges: Steps to Follow

Here are the things that you must have before you begin refilling your cartridges.

  • Ink-refilling kits(syringe, seal cover, etc.)
  • Gloves
  • Paper towel
  • Quality Ink

Printer manufacturing companies in India don't advise refilling most cartridges. But you can find reliable companies selling high-quality ink-refilling kits. They work well, just like the replaced cartridges.

So, if your printer is running out of ink, do not delay. Gather all the essential things you need and start refilling the cartridge.

The steps for refilling cartridges for an inkjet printer are as follows.

Step 1: Buy a high-quality ink refill kit, including a syringe, seal cover, etc., for your printer from the nearest retail store.

Step 2: Wear gloves and Cover the workspace with paper or cloth, as the ink stains are hard to remove.

Step 3: Remove the cartridge gently and wipe it with a soft paper towel.

Step 4: Place the cartridge on a paper towel and find the ink-fill hole. In some cartridges, you have to puncture them by yourself.

Step 5: Fill the syringe with ink and pour it.

Step 6: When it’s filled up, cover the hole with tape and set the cartridge back to the printer.

The steps for refilling a cartridge for laser printers are as follows:

Step 1: Buy the toner appropriate for your printer.

Step 2: Melt a hole into the machine with the help of a toner refill tool found online.

Step 3: Clean the hopper to make sure it is empty before being refilled.

Step 4: Pour the toner inside the cartridge.

Step 5: Once it’s filled, reinsert the cartridge into the printer.
